Explain how reasoning models can charge for tokens the caller never sees in the response. Cover what those hidden tokens are, why they cost real money, and how providers typically surface them in usage accounting.
Reasoning models generate a hidden chain-of-thought before the visible answer. Those tokens cost real GPU decode time and bill as output tokens, often dwarfing the visible reply by 10-100x.
Picture a student who scribbles three pages of working notes to figure out a math problem and then writes a one-line answer on the test sheet. The teacher only sees the one line, but if they were paying the student per page of work produced, they would owe for the notes too. A reasoning model is the same. Before it writes the final answer you see, it generates a long internal scratchpad of partial reasoning, hypothesis checks, and self-corrections. The provider's GPU did real work for every one of those scratchpad tokens, so the bill includes them. The visible reply might be 50 tokens, but the line item on your invoice can show 5,000 output tokens because the model wrote 4,950 tokens worth of hidden thinking to get there.

Comparing reasoning models to non-reasoning models on the length of the visible answer. The reasoning model looks cheap by that metric and ruinously expensive on the actual bill, because thinking tokens dominate output count.
